Premium Hotels in Turin
Rivarolo Canavese
Turin
Turin
Turin
Turin
You are booking hotel for more than 30 days
Your Budget
Show 5 more
Locality
Popular locations
Show -3 more
Popular in Turin
Loger Confort Residence & Apartments
(406 Ratings)
NPR 88,275
+ NPR 8,827 taxes & fees
Per Night
Hotel Diplomatic
Based on 964 Ratings
(964 Ratings)
NPR 70,429
+ NPR 7,043 taxes & fees
Per Night
Rivarolo Canavese
Turin
Turin
Turin
Turin